Section A. Background

    On October 20, 1999, the Commission issued its final Rule pursuant 
to the Children's Online Privacy Protection Act, 15 U.S.C. 6501 et 
seq., which became effective on April 21, 2000.\1\ On December 19, 
2012, the Commission amended the Rule, and these amendments became 
effective on July 1, 2013.\2\ The Rule requires certain website and 
online service operators to post privacy policies and provide notice, 
and obtain verifiable parental consent, prior to collecting, using, or 
disclosing personal information from children under the age of 13.\3\ 
The Rule contains a ``safe harbor'' provision enabling industry groups 
or others to submit to the Commission for approval self-regulatory 
guidelines that would implement the Rule's protections.\4\
---------------------------------------------------------------------------

    \1\ 64 FR 59888 (1999).
    \2\ 78 FR 3972 (2013).
    \3\ 16 CFR part 312.
    \4\ See 16 CFR 312.11; 78 FR at 3995-96, 4012-13.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------

    Pursuant to Section 312.11 of the Rule, ESRB submitted proposed 
self-regulatory guidelines to the Commission that the FTC approved in 
2001. ESRB subsequently updated its guidelines to comply with the 
revised Rule, which became effective on July 1, 2013. ESRB is now 
seeking to modify its Commission-approved Safe Harbor program 
requirements. The text of the proposed modified program requirements is 
available on the Commission's website, at www.ftc.gov.

Section B. Questions on the Proposed Modified Program Requirements

    The Commission is seeking comment on various aspects of ESRB's 
proposed modified program requirements, and is particularly interested 
in receiving comment on the questions that follow. These questions are 
designed to assist the public and should not be construed as a 
limitation on the issues on which public comment may be submitted. Each 
response should cite the number and subsection of the question being 
answered. For all comments submitted, please provide any relevant data, 
statistics, or any other evidence, upon which those comments are based.
    1. Please provide comments on any or all of the proposed 
modifications to ESRB's program requirements. For each provision 
commented on please describe (a) the impact of the provision(s), 
including benefits and costs, if any, and (b) what alternatives, if 
any, should be considered, as well as the costs and benefits of those 
alternatives.
    2. Are the mechanisms used to assess operators' compliance with the 
proposed modified program requirements effective? \5\ If not, please 
describe (a) whether and how ESRB could modify the assessment 
mechanisms to satisfy the Rule's requirements, and (b) the costs and 
benefits of those modifications.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------

    \5\ See 16 CFR 312.11(b)(2); 78 FR at 4013.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------

    3. Are the incentives for operators' compliance with the proposed 
modified program requirements effective? \6\ If not, please describe 
(a) whether and how the incentives could be modified to satisfy the 
Rule's requirements, and (b) the costs and benefits of those 
modifications.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------

    \6\ See 16 CFR 312.11(b)(3); 78 FR at 4013.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------

    4. Please provide comments on any other issue deemed relevant to 
this matter.
